The biopic is reportedly titled as “Warhol” and the movie will depict the dramatic life of the artist.

Jared Leto has confirmed that he will play revered artist Andy Warhol in an upcoming movie.

The actor confirmed via his Instagram that he would be portraying the artist in his next film and the movie is reportedly titled as "Warhol."

The prolific artist achieved much in his short career and the biopic will shed light on his dramatic life. From collaborating with bands like The Rolling Stones, The Velvet Underground, to creating one of the most liberating place for artists in New York "The Factory".

Many believe it'd also cover Valerie Jean Solanas' influence on Warhol's life. Valerie was an American radical feminist and a self-published author.

Andy Warhol still remains an international pop icon. His artwork depicted a seemingly bland Campbell Soup cans.

However, there is a controversy surrounding the film as Warhol was an openly gay icon. Thus, Leto will  be again seen playing LGBTQ+ character after his Oscar-winning role in Dallas Buyers Club.
